Title:
PRODUCTION OF ACRYLIC CARBON FIBER

Abstract:

PURPOSE: Acrylic fibers are heated in an oxidative atmosphere and heated in an inert gas atmosphere at higher temperatures, then carbonized to shorten the time for preoxidation and produce the titled fiber of high strength.

CONSTITUTION: Fibers of acrylonitrile containing acrylic acid or the like are heated at 230W350°C in an oxygen-containing atmosphere to form a fiber of about 5W8wt% oxygen content. Then, the resultant fibers are subjected to 2- stage heat treatment in a temperature range from higher than the above one to 450°C in an inert gas atmosphere such as nitrogen to give fibers convertible into carbon fibers containing less than 8wt% oxygen. The fibers are further heated at higher than 1,000°C in an inert atmospher to effect carbonization or graphitization to give the objective acrylic carbon fibers.
